Why These Are the Top Jeep Repair Auto Repair Shops in Columbia

** The Jeep repair market in Columbia, Alabama, reflects its status as a small, rural town. There is a high demand for capable 4x4 services due to local hunting, farming, and recreational off-roading culture. However, the supply is bifurcated: * **Local Generalists:** The in-town market is served by a small number of general auto repair shops, like **Columbia Auto & Tire**, which provide essential maintenance and basic 4WD repairs. They offer convenience and local trust but may lack the specialized equipment and inventory for complex modifications or high-performance engine work. * **Regional Specialists:** For specialized needs (lift kits, engine swaps, advanced diagnostics), residents of Columbia consistently look to the larger market in **Dothan**, AL, located approximately 20-25 minutes away. Shops like **Southern Offroad Specialists** and **Wiregrass 4x4 & Performance** dominate this segment, offering SEMA-quality builds and manufacturer-specific training. **Competition Level:** Moderate. While there are few direct competitors within Columbia's city limits, the nearby Dothan market is highly competitive, driving a high standard of quality and specialization among the top-tier providers. **Typical Pricing:** * **Basic Services (Oil Change, Brakes):** Competitive with national chains. * **Intermediate (Lift Kit Installation):** $800 - $1,500 for a mid-range suspension kit installation. * **Advanced (Engine/Differential Rebuild, Custom Fabrication):** Premium pricing, starting at $2,500 and scaling significantly with complexity, but aligned with regional standards for expert work. In summary, Columbia residents have access to excellent Jeep care by leveraging both a reliable local garage for everyday needs and top-tier regional specialists for serious off-road modifications and repairs.
